cura-mcp

An MCP server that lets an AI agent (Claude, etc.) slice 3D models with UltiMaker Cura (the CuraEngine backend) headlessly — no GUI, no clicking. Load STL files, pick a printer profile, override any Cura setting, and get back a ready-to-print .gcode plus the estimated print time.

Built because Cura has no official MCP and its engine is awkward to run standalone — this wraps it cleanly.

What it exposes

Tool

What it does

list_printers

List available printer profiles (id, build volume, nozzle).

get_profile

Return the full settings of a profile, to inspect or tweak.

slice

Slice one or more STL files with a profile + optional setting overrides → gcode + print time.

Example: "Slice part.stl on the Creasee 340 with 0.16 mm layers, 5 walls, 30% infill, and a raft." → the agent calls slice(stl_paths=["/…/part.stl"], printer_id="creasee340", settings={"layer_height":0.16,"wall_line_count":5,"infill_sparse_density":30,"adhesion_type":"raft"}).

Why this was hard (and how it's solved)

CuraEngine from the Cura AppImage doesn't run standalone: it needs (1) the AppImage's bundled ld-linux interpreter, (2) all of the AppImage's shared libraries, and (3) a complete, flattened set of settings (fdmprinter + fdmextruder defaults + your overrides) — miss one and it aborts. engine.py handles all three: it runs CuraEngine via the bundled linker with a full library path, and flattens Cura's nested settings tree into the ~400 -s key=value flags CuraEngine expects.

Requirements

  • Linux, Python ≥ 3.10.

  • UltiMaker Cura AppImage extracted to ~/opt/cura/squashfs-root (or set CURA_ROOT):

    cd ~/opt/cura && /path/to/UltiMaker-Cura-*.AppImage --appimage-extract

Install

git clone <this repo> && cd cura-mcp
python3 -m venv .venv && ./.venv/bin/pip install -e .

Use with Claude Code

claude mcp add cura-slicer -- /ABS/PATH/cura-mcp/.venv/bin/python -m cura_mcp

Then restart your session and ask Claude to slice a model.

Printer profiles

Profiles live in src/cura_mcp/profiles/*.json as {name, manufacturer, description, settings:{…Cura settings…}}. Ships with Creasee 340 (large CR-10-class bowden printer, CR-Touch ABL, quality profile tuned for a slightly warped bed) and a generic 220 mm printer. Add your own by dropping a JSON file in that folder.

Notes

  • Print time and filament are computed from the actual toolpaths (analyze_gcode), so they vary with settings and model — reliable estimates.

  • License AGPL-3.0 (CuraEngine is AGPL; this wrapper follows).
